Just Another Sucker was the first single to be released from the first collection of 94 East tracks, Minneapolis Genius. It was released around the same time as the album on 12" vinyl only, and contains the album version of the song (incorrectly labeled as Urban/Club Version) and an edited version (incorrectly labeled as Album version). The song Just Another Sucker was co-written by Prince and Pepé Willie, and features Prince on guitar, synthesizer, keyboards and drums.
The single was not promoted, but did briefly enter the Billboard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Songs chart.
